When the Governing Body of our local church first set out to create our own non-profit corporation and govern what would eventually become the “Keeseekoose Full Gospel Fellowship”, and then ultimately the “International Full Gospel Fellowship and International Full Gospel University”, which currently hosts the “College of Bishops” who oversee our Clergical Training, Ordination and licensing body; we decided on an approach we found in the fourth chapter of the book of Ephesians.
Simply said, we chose to create a Council of Five. We began seating an Apostle, Prophet, Evangelist, Pastor, and Teacher to work together in crafting our organization. Now I don’t advise everyone to take this absolute approach in their ministries but for me it only makes the best sense. Why? Because the Word of God states that this group is chiefly responsible for mine, yours, and everyone else’s maturation into perfection.
Actually in Ephesians chapter four and the thirteenth verse it says that this work and unity will eventually even guide & mature us in the Faith and Knowledge of God until we measure up to the fullness of the stature of Jesus. Wow!
I just can not possibly think of anything greater in all of existence then to be like Jesus! He is full of Mercy, Full of Grace, Full of Power, Full of Authority and Full of Love. Seriously? And right here in Ephesians, the Word of God promises that the five gifted ministries Jesus gave are the key instructors in lifting me to the fullness of the stature of the King– Lord Jesus! That is where this distinction was created, back when Jesus chose twelve disciplined disciples to make Apostles.
Aside from the obvious qualities of character and faith one had to possess to be an Apostle, there was a particular quality considered when the original eleven were replacing the Apostle Judas. The candidate had to have had a personal revelation/encounter with the risen Christ. The Apostle is one who is sent. The Apostle is almost synonymous with the office of the Bishop, and really is the key to all church business and order. When you really need to know, the Apostle has an answer for you if the road to hearing from heaven is obscured. When the heavens are brass and you have prayed and prayed God will send an apostle with direction.
The Apostle, according to Ephesians chapter four, is one fifth of the team it takes to perfect the church.

Let`s look though at the prophet`s reward. Matthew 10:41 The bible tells us that anyone that receives a Prophet in the name of a Prophet shall receive a Prophet’s Reward. Now some people think that if they can locate a prophet, that they can have them prophesy some finance into their life. or they will get a word from the prophet and then somehow, all of a sudden-like, know what their ministry is supposed to entail. Please don’t get me wrong, I concede that both of these things can and do happen, however, in the majority of cases this is greed and laziness at work.
We do not need a prophet to communicate with God for us! We can, with boldness, enter into the throne room of God for ourselves; thanks to Jesus’s finished work on the cross! And so far as prophesying things into our lives, every single believer on earth has such authority, in Jesus’s name.
Since it was common practice in ancient days to honor the prophet with gifts, many also think a prophet’s reward is money or possessions. Naturally then, many false prophets have preyed on folks falsely telling them that if they will believe that, they are a prophet, then, say they, “Give to a prophet in the name of a prophet and you will receive a prophet’s reward.”
In those classic days gone by, the days of Elijah, & Elisha, a prophet only had ONE THING that motivated him or her… A reward, so far as a prophet was concerned, and still today should be, was to see their prophesy come to pass. Period. That is what a prophet’s reward was. When you received a prophet, in the name of a prophet, you accessed that particular blessing! You benefited by having that word of prophesy come to pass in your life! Furthermore, a prophet whose prophesy failed to come to pass was stoned to death, so in the reward is the winning of their life, a true prophet’s reward.
Prophet’s are passionate, not arrogant and prideful. God’s hates a proud look and a haughty spirit. A true prophet does not exude an “I’m the prophet” demeanor.
Prophets were not a fly by night, ambiguously speaking group, but honorable and sober sons to others, who, were called and validated in the vein of the prophets themselves. To receive a prophet IN THE NAME OF A PROPHET, possibly you can understand this better by thinking about Elisha, who had the name of Elijah for a mentor and father in the office of the prophetic order.
